Abstract

La presente invención está relacionada con una composición que comprende al menos un polipéptido, polipéptido el cual comprende la secuencia de aminoácidos descripta en cualquiera de las SEQ ID NO: 1 a 51 o 101 a 111, o una secuencia de aminoácidos que tiene al menos aproximadamente 80% de identidad de secuencia con estas, polipéptido el cual es capaz de unirse a un hongo. La presente invención además está relacionada con una composición que comprende al menos un polipéptido, polipéptido el cual comprende una región CDR1 que tiene la secuencia de aminoácidos descripta en cualquiera de las SEQ ID NO: 52 a 67 o 112 a 122, una región CDR2 que tiene la secuencia de aminoácidos descripta en cualquiera de las SEQ 15 ID NO: 68 a 83 o 123 a 133, y una región CDR3 que tiene la secuencia de aminoácidos descripta en cualquiera de las SEQ ID NO: 84 a 100 o 134 a 144 y dicho polipéptido es capaz de unirse a un hongo. Las composiciones se pueden usar como composiciones antifúngicas.
